TL;DR
GovCon is an AI proposal-writing tool built specifically for U.S. federal contractors, with integrated live opportunity discovery, AI drafting and an application-based access model. Privia is bid management for federal government contractors and large enterprise capture teams. Privia is a U.S. enterprise capture and proposal management platform widely used by federal government contractors and large defense/IT primes. Strong on capture workflow, teaming and review-cycle (color-team) management.

Where Privia is stronger
GovCon isn't the right tool for every team. Privia is genuinely stronger in these areas:
- Mature capture management, gate-review and teaming workflow for very large proposals
- Strong fit with formal federal acquisition (FAR/DFARS) capture processes
Best for GovCon
Small-business offerors writing federal proposals without enterprise capture-management overhead.
Best for Privia
Federal contractors and defense primes running large, multi-month capture campaigns.
